Doctorate of Education, Ed.D. in Higher Educational Leadership from California State University, Stanislaus

Master's of Art, M.A. in Sociology with a concentration in Social Psychology from Bowling Green State University, OH

Dual Bachelors (B.A. & B.S.) in Sociology and Social Work from Xavier University, OH

Dr. Summers grew up in Ohio and has two adult children, son (Investment Analyst & Stock Broker) and daughter 28, (Assistant Human Resources Director).  Dr. Summers work background: 22 years of college teaching experience from Illinois, Arizona, Washington State, and California; previous Department Chair, tenured, Sociology & Social Work Professor; Data Specialist for University of Illinois, Chicago, National Research and Training Center (NRTC); Assistant Director of The Population Society & Research Center at Bowling Green State University, OH; previous Licensed Social Worker (LSW) for the State OH; Army Veteran, Honorably Discharged (both active and reserves). 

Work and Consulting Experience

Career at Santa Rosa Junior College began in 2018.  He also teaches at San Joaquin Delta College in Stockton, CA and Holy Names University, in Oakland, CA

22 years of college teaching experience at 2-year, 4-year, and graduate institutions

Previous college Department Chair, Articulation Task Force Leader, and University Data Specialist

Institutional research, program development/management of academic support for at-risk student populations, and overseeing student learning outcomes assessment (SLO)

Program management and implementation of first-year, student experience 

Advanced-level quantitative and qualitative research in higher education policy evaluation and developing predictive models on measuring institutional data on student success indicators
